Abstract: Presentation Topic: 'Student Learning Through Goal Attainment and Success'

All advisors understand the importance of teaching and coaching our students on setting and successfully attaining goals, short and long term, during their educational experiences. Getting from point A to point B successfully is a continuous process for the student. But what happens along the way? How does the journey affect the next trips taken down the goal success pathway?

This presentation discusses what students can and should learn on the way from the starting block to the finish line of their educational endeavors, both short and long term. Development of personal traits such as self-discipline, perseverance, emotional intelligence, and flexibility, along with subject matter material, make the process of goal success and attainment an academically and personally robust, rewarding, and lifelong learning experience.
